Aztecs top Titans in semifinals, 2-1, return to CIF boys soccer championship game

The winner of Tuesday’s San Diego Section Division II boys soccer semifinal playoff match between the host Montgomery Aztecs and Eastlake Titans definitely received the spoils: a trip to Saturday’s division championship game.

The seventh-seeded Aztecs (15-3-4) prevailed by a 2-1 score over the 11th-seeded Titans (14-10-2) to meet fifth-seeded Mission Hills (16-7-3) in the division final. Kick-off for the Division II championship game is 4:30 p.m. at Mission Bay High School.

“It’s really exciting,” conceded Montgomery freshman center-back Jorge Osorio. “I think we have the team to win state.”

Oscar Godinez gave the Aztecs a 1-0 lead in the first half before Eastlake’s Samay Rahim tied the score. Ruben Aguiniga scored the game-winner on a skipping shot under the Titan goalkeeper in the second half.

Both teams missed a penalty kick in the game.

Montgomery advanced to Tuesday’s semifinal after slaying second-seeded Granite Hills, 2-1, in last Friday’s quarterfinals. Issac Cobian and Julian Castro each scored goals to lift the visiting Aztecs.

Montgomery is returning to familiar territory. The Aztecs won the Division IV title in 2015.

“We’ve been preparing for CIF all year,” Osorio said. “Our forwards and midfielders are seniors. They’ve been playing since they were freshmen. They’re starters.”

The Division II playoffs proved to highlight several notable upsets as Mission Hills upset top-seeded San Diego, 3-2, in Tuesday’s semifinals.

In fact, the top four-seeded teams in the division all were eliminated before reaching the final.

Eastlake upset third-seeded Rancho Bernardo, 4-3, in kicks from the mark tie-breaker in last Friday’s quarterfinals while Mission Hills eliminated fourth-seeded Fallbrook, 1-0, in the same playoff round.

In fact, Eastlake recorded a series of upsets in its run to the semifinals. The Titans defeated Southwest El Centro, 1-0, in a play-in game on Feb. 20, then promptly upset sixth-seeded Bishop’s, 2-1, in the opening round of bracket play on Feb. 22.

Aidan Osborn scored the game-winner in the play-in game against Southwest El Centro (8-7-6) while Sebastian Martinez and Rahim each scored goals in the win over Bishop’s (12-6-4).

Rahim notched the lone regulation goal for the Titans in their quarterfinal match against Rancho Bernardo (10-4-4) while goalkeeper Andres Rovira recorded 16 saves in 80 minutes of regulation play and 15 minutes of overtime before the KFM tie-breaker.

Rahim, a junior, led Eastlake in season scoring with 11 goals and seven assists while Rovira recorded a stingy 0.985 goals-against-average in 20 game appearances.

Montgomery began its playoff odyssey with a 2-1 opening round win over 10th-seeded Escondido (7-6-5) before knocking off Granite Hills (11-8-7) in the quarterfinals.

Otay Ranch (7-10-5) and San Ysidro (9-11-3) also participated in the Division II playoffs.

Otay Ranch defeated ninth-seeded Francis Parker (11-6-4) by a score of 3-2 in the opening round before ending its season with a 3-1 loss to the top-seeded Cavers (13-6-4) in the quarterfinals.

San Ysidro dropped a 3-1 play-in match to Grossmont (11-10-4).

Sixth-seeded Olympian fell short in Tuesday’s Division III semifinal match against second-seeded Hoover, 7-6, in the KFM tiebreaker. The teams had battled to a scoreless tie through regulation and overtime.

The Eagles (12-8-3) had eliminated third-seeded Bonita Vista, 5-4, in the KFM tiebreaker in last Friday’s quarterfinals.
Olympian edged 11th-seeded King-Chavez Community, 1-0, in the opening round on a goal by Enrique Avalos.

Bonita Vista, this year’s Mesa League champion, finished 11-5-4, 8-1-1 in league.

Hoover (14-5-5) advances to meet fifth-seeded Del Norte (14-5-5) in Saturday’s Division III championship game.

Freshman David Kay led Olympian in season scoring with 10 goals and two assists.

Getting their kicks
All three Metro Conference girls soccer teams advanced from Wednesday’s San Diego Section semifinals.

•Mesa League champion Eastlake, seeded second in the Division I field, outlasted third-seeded Patrick Henry, 4-3, in a kicks from the mark shootout. Leyla McFarland scored the game-winner.

•Montgomery, seeded second in the Division IV bracket, edged third-seeded La Jolla Country Day by a score of 2-1.

•Third-seeded Otay Ranch upset second-seeded Sage Creek, 5-4, in the KFM tiebreaker in Division III.
